Liverpool Youngster Bradley’s Father tragically passes away shortly after scoring his first goal for the Reds
Liverpool youngster Conor Bradley is mourning the death of his father at the age of 58. The Premier League club confirmed the sad news on Saturday, with Joe Bradley passing away three days after his son’s first senior goal for the Reds.
A Promising Performance
Bradley was named man-of-the-match for his outstanding performance in Wednesday’s 4-1 victory over Chelsea. The 19-year-old full-back showcased his skills and made a significant impact on the game by providing two crucial assists. It was undoubtedly a night to remember for young Bradley as he celebrated his first senior goal for the club.
A Heartbreaking Loss
However, the joyous moment quickly turned into sorrow as news broke that Bradley’s father had passed away. Reports from Northern Ireland suggest that he had been battling illness for some time before his unfortunate demise. The sudden loss has left the young Liverpool player heartbroken.
Liverpool’s Statement of Condolence
Liverpool Football Club expressed their deep sadness over the tragic news in a brief statement. “Liverpool FC is deeply saddened by the death of Conor Bradley’s father, Joe, today,” the club said. They extended their sympathies and support to Conor and the entire Bradley family during this difficult and sad time.
